How do I know if I need a roof replacement rather than just a repair?

It depends on the age and overall condition of your roof. If you’re seeing multiple leaks, missing or broken shingles, and extensive damage from weather or rot, a full replacement may be more cost-effective than repeated repairs. An inspection from a trusted roofing professional in Pikeville can help determine if a repair or replacement is your best option.

What types of roofing materials are available for a high-quality roof replacement?

There are several options, each with unique benefits. Asphalt shingles are popular and budget-friendly, metal roofing is durable and energy-efficient, and slate or tile roofing offers a classic look with outstanding longevity. By discussing your budget, style preferences, and local climate conditions in Pikeville, you can choose the material that best fits your needs.

How long does a typical roof replacement take?

Most residential roof replacements take one to three days, depending on factors like roof size, material type, and weather conditions. Additional complexities such as a steep pitch, extensive repairs to the underlying structure, or unexpected discoveries (e.g., rotten decking) can extend this timeframe.

Will the roof replacement process disrupt my daily routine?

There may be some noise and vibration during the replacement process, but professional roofers take steps to minimize any inconvenience. It’s best to keep cars and other valuables away from the work area. Typically, you can remain at home during the project, but some homeowners choose to leave for a few hours during particularly noisy phases.

Does homeowners insurance cover the cost of a roof replacement?

It depends on your specific policy and the cause of the damage. Many insurance policies cover replacements if the damage is caused by storms, fire, or other covered events. However, normal wear and tear or lack of maintenance are often excluded. Contact your insurance provider or speak with your roofing contractor for guidance on the claims process.

How long will my new roof last, and do you offer any warranties?

A new roof’s lifespan depends on the chosen material and how well you maintain it. Asphalt shingle roofs can last around 20–30 years, while metal roofs and premium materials like slate can last 40+ years. Reputable contractors in Pikeville typically provide a workmanship warranty, and the roofing material itself usually comes with a manufacturer’s warranty for additional peace of mind.
